Ohimegye-Igu Of Koton-karfe, HRM, Saidu Akawu Salihu Turbans 25 Subjects, Urges Them To Be Good Ambassadors

By Abubakar Suleman
The Ohimegye Igu of Koton-Karfe and Chairman, Lokoja/Kogi Local Government Areas Traditional Council, Alhaji (Dr.) Saidu Akawu Salihu, has turbaned twenty five indigenes of the Emirate, charging them to be good ambassadors wherever they are.
The monarch who stated this at his palace in Koton-Karfe during the turbaning of the new title holders on Friday said that the recipients were conferred with various traditional titles based on merit and on their eminent contributions to the Kingdom and the state in particular.
He pointed out that everybody is aware of the contributions made by all the newly turbaned traditional title holders.
He then urged them to continue with their work that earned them these biggest traditional titles in his kingdom.
He prayed Allah to bless the titles given to them also to give them strength and wisdom to do more, calling on others to emulate them.
Responding on behalf of other newly turbaned traditional title holders,
Yahaya Shuiabu Tatu, who was conferred with the title of OGAZA OGBANI of Igu Kingdom thanked the Ohimegye-Igu for the honour done to them and promised that they would do more.
Dignitaries at the well attended ceremony include; His Royal Highness, The Maigari of Lokoja, Alhaji Ibrahim Kabir Maikarfi IV, the Speaker, Kogi State House of Assembly, Rt. Hon. Yusuf Aliyu, Kogi State Commissioner for Solid Minerals and Natural Resources, Engr, Abubakar Bashir Gegu, top government officials, politicians and traditional rulers within and outside Igu Kingdom.
